Common Car Locking Issues and How a Local Locksmith Can Help
Lost or Stolen Car Keys
Problem: Losing car keys can be a difficult and troublesome experience. It can leave you stranded and susceptible to theft.Option: A local locksmith can produce a brand-new set of keys based upon your car's make, design, and year. They can also program brand-new electronic keys if your car utilizes a transponder or chip key.
Locked Out of Your Car
Issue: Accidentally locking your type in the car can be an aggravating circumstance, specifically if you need to get someplace rapidly.Solution: A locksmith can rapidly and effectively open your car without causing damage to the vehicle. They use specialized tools and techniques to gain entry securely.
Jammed Ignition
Issue: A jammed ignition can avoid your car from starting, leaving you stranded.Solution: A locksmith can diagnose the problem and either repair or replace the ignition lock cylinder. They can likewise supply tips to prevent future jams.
Broken Car Locks
Problem: Damaged car locks can compromise the security of your vehicle and make it hard to lock or unlock the doors.Solution: A locksmith can replace broken locks and rekey your car to ensure that all locks are integrated and safe and secure.

Q1: How much does it cost to get a brand-new car key made by a locksmith?
A1: The cost can differ depending on the kind of key and the complexity of the car's locking system. Typically, an easy key duplication can cost in between ₤ 20 and ₤ 50, while a transponder key programming can range from ₤ 50 to ₤ 200.
Q2: Can a locksmith unlock my car without damaging it?
A2: Yes, professional locksmiths are trained to use non-destructive approaches to unlock cars and trucks. They use specialized tools to get entry without triggering any damage to the vehicle.
